Question

When verifying that an autonomous AI-based system is acting appropriately, which of the following are MOST important to include?

Options

  • ATest cases to verify that the system automatically confirms the correct classification of training
  • BTest cases to detect the system appropriately automating its data input
  • CTest cases to detect the system prompting for unnecessary human intervention
  • DTest cases to verify that the system automatically suppresses invalid output data

Explanation

The syllabus highlights that testing for unnecessary human intervention is a key focus for autonomous AI-based systems: "For autonomous AI-based systems, testers must ensure that the system does not prompt for unnecessary human intervention, as this contradicts the autonomy concept."
